public interface ModuleCommandFactory
Scopes.GLOBALcomponent and as such cannot have
Injectmethods referring to
Scopes.NAMED_CACHEscoped components. For such components, use a corresponding
|Modifier and Type||Method and Description|
Construct and initialize a
Provides a map of command IDs to command types of all the commands handled by the command factory instance.
Map<Byte,Class<? extends ReplicableCommand>> getModuleCommands()
ReplicableCommand fromStream(byte commandId, Object args)
ReplicableCommandbased on the command id and argument array passed in.
commandId- command id to construct
args- array of arguments with which to initialize the ReplicableCommand
Copyright © 2014 JBoss, a division of Red Hat. All Rights Reserved.